Transaction 24a34b556a0108945804405f73f3193dd1498be3bfbebc01c98a20099dbc700a
1 Input
1 Output
-
24a34b556a0108945804405f73f3193dd1498be3bfbebc01c98a20099dbc700a:0
- value
- 327637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dbe8b87a1c49401822c4690aabec2a0ebdfc9cf OP_EQUAL
- address
- 3LStiAqKfG14hzrzgXvvfnVvZcTmN7UXLx